Connor O'Gara and Will Ogburn return to the mic for The OG Kickoff -  your new home for authentic SEC football talk. We’re bringing you the same chemistry and hard-hitting coverage you’ve followed for years, straight from the source. From the latest news and biggest stories to the game's most interesting players and coaches, we cover the conference with the depth of insiders and the passion of fans. 365 days a year, we talk about the past present and future of the SEC in a way that nobody else does.
